dc.description.abstractAbstract There are many methods have been developed to arrange the array values in various ways for a database cold the sorting algorithms. The classification of sorting algorithms base on System complexity of computational, terms of number of swaps, Memory usage Stability of sorting algorithms . In this researsh we seek to detemiine the efficiency of the various sorting algorithms according to the time and number of swaps by using randomized trails. The build environment using the Java language. We represents these sorting algorithms bubble sort, selection sort, insertion, sort quick sort and merge sort as a way to sort an array or integers and run random trails of length. I created a package called “sorting” to execute a sort, it provided module of sorting list(Non decreased &decreased) uses different method of sorting ,the amount of swaps of each sorting algorithm and the runtime (in millisecond) and I found a quick sort is the fastest algorithm compare to Bubble sort, Insertion sort, Selection sort, and merge sort.en_US
